Ingredients for Old-Fashioned Salmon Patties:

  • 2 cans (6 oz each) of salmon (preferably with bones and skin removed, or use fresh salmon if preferred)
  • 1/2 cup breadcrumbs (preferably whole wheat for a healthier option)
  • 1/4 cup finely chopped onion
  • 1/4 cup finely chopped celery (optional, but adds a great crunch)
  • 1 large egg
  • 2 tablespoons mayonnaise (or Greek yogurt for a lighter version)
  • 1 tablespoon Dijon mustard
  • 1 tablespoon fresh lemon juice
  • 1 teaspoon dried dill (or fresh if available)
  • 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t (or to taste)
  • Olive oil or vegetable oil for frying

Step-by-Step Instructions:

1. Prepare the Salmon

If using canned salmon, drain the salmon and remove any skin and bones (if desired, the bones can be kept for extra calcium and nutrients). Flake the salmon with a fork and place it in a large bowl. If using fresh salmon, cook it through, cool it slightly, and flake it into pieces.

2. Mix the Ingredients

In the bowl with the salmon, add the breadcrumbs, chopped onion, chopped celery, egg, mayonnaise, Dijon mustard, lemon juice, dill, garlic powder, black pepper, and salt. Mix everything together until the ingredients are well incorporated. You should have a slightly sticky mixture that holds together when shaped.

3. Form the Patties

Take about 2-3 tablespoons of the salmon mixture and shape it into a patty, pressing it together gently to form a round shape. Repeat until all the mixture is used up, making 6-8 patties, depending on the size you prefer.

4. Fry the Patties

Heat a couple of tablespoons of o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Once the oil is hot, add the patties to the pan, being careful not to overcrowd them. Fry the patties for 3-4 minutes per side, or until golden brown and crispy. Flip the patties carefully to avoid breaking them.

5. Drain and Serve

Once the patties are cooked and crispy on both sides, transfer them to a paper towel-lined plate to drain any excess oil. Serve the patties hot with your favorite sides, such as a fresh salad, roasted vegetables, or a dipping sauce like tartar sauce or aioli.


Tips for Perfectly Crispy Salmon Patties:

  • Don’t overwork the mixture: Mix the ingredients just enough to combine them. Overworking the mixture can result in dense patties that don’t hold together as well.
  • Use chilled ingredients: If the mixture feels too soft, chill it in the fridge for 15-20 minutes before forming the patties. This helps them hold their shape better when frying.
  • Make them your own: Add different seasonings like paprika, cayenne pepper, or parsley to customize the flavor. You can also mix in other veggies like bell peppers or zucchini for added texture and nutrition.
  • Frying: Make sure the oil is hot before adding the patties to the pan. If the oil is too cool, the patties may become soggy. A good test is to drop a breadcrumb into the oil; if it sizzles immediately, the oil is ready.

Why These Salmon Patties are Great:

  • Quick and Easy: With minimal ingredients and prep time, these salmon patties are a fast and hassle-free meal.
  • Nutrient-Rich: Salmon is a great source of omega-3 fatty acids, protein, and essential vitamins. These patties provide a healthy dose of these nutrients while still being light and tasty.
  • Versatile: Serve them as a main dish, in a sandwich, or on top of a salad. You can also enjoy them with a side of homemade fries or as a snack.
  • Budget-Friendly: Using canned salmon makes this dish an affordable option without compromising on flavor or nutrition.

FAQ for Old-Fashioned Salmon Patties:


1. Can I use fresh salmon instead of canned salmon?

Yes, you can use fresh salmon! Simply cook it through (grill, bake, or pan-sear), then flake it and use it in place of canned salmon. Fresh salmon adds a slightly different texture, but it will still work beautifully in this recipe.


2. How do I keep the patties from falling apart?

To help the patties hold together, make sure to use enough breadcrumbs and egg to bind the mixture. If needed, you can refrigerate the patty mixture for 15-20 minutes before shaping to allow it to firm up. Additionally, handle the patties gently when frying and avoid flipping them too soon.


3. Can I make these salmon patties gluten-free?

Yes, simply swap the regular breadcrumbs with gluten-free breadcrumbs or use ground almonds or crushed rice crackers as a substitute.


4. Can I bake the salmon patties instead of frying them?

Yes, you can bake the salmon patties!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C) and place the patties on a lightly greased baking sheet. Bake for 15-20 minutes, flipping halfway through, until they’re golden and crispy on the outside.


5. Can I freeze these salmon patties?

Absolutely! You can freeze the uncooked patties by placing them on a baking sheet and freezing them until firm, then transferring them to a freezer-safe bag or container. When ready to cook, simply thaw in the fridge and fry as usual. You can also freeze cooked patties for up to 2 months.


6. What can I serve with salmon patties?

Salmon patties are great with a variety of sides! Try serving them with a light salad, roasted vegetables, steamed broccoli, or mashed sweet potatoes. You can also place them on a bun with lettuce, tomato, and a dollop of tartar sauce for a delicious salmon burger.


7. How do I store leftover salmon patties?

Leftover salmon patties can be stored in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. To reheat, place them in a hot skillet for a few minutes on each side or bake them at 350°F (175°C) until heated through.
